Head to Roblox Support

Enter the date of birth associated with her account (She better should be over 17, so they take the situation more seriously)

Then fill out the form like this.

In Description of Issue, re-explain the situation with these proofs:

  • Include the date of birth of your girlfriend (Some random guy on Quora got their account back just by saying this)

  • Include her account email (which was made in 2019)

  • Include your girlfriend’s account username.

  • If she has any videos recorded while she was playing Roblox, you better include these as some kind of proof.

  • Tell them that she knows and remembers the password of her Roblox account.

  • If she has Anything that proves her ownership of the account, just send it.

Then tell them that you’d like to switch the verified email on her account to her current one.

That’s all you can do. There’s a quite high chance of getting the account back, but I can’t guarantee.

You better speak as if you were her, don’t make it look like you’re her friend and trying to get her account back.

Best of luck!
